[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Kim Gui-yeol] Yeongyang-gun, Gyeongbuk Province, decided on the 26th to participate in the Hope 2023 Sharing Campaign to provide some support to neighbors in need within the district by donating the entire prize money received as an excellent institution in the Safe Korea Training.


Yeongyang County Office was selected as an excellent institution in the 2022 Disaster Response Safe Korea Training held from the 21st to the 25th of last month and received a prize of 1.5 million KRW. The entire prize money will be donated to the Gyeongbuk Community Chest to be delivered to neighbors facing difficulties during the year-end and New Year holidays.


Woo Je-hak, Head of the Construction Safety Division, said, “Today, the last day of my 28 years of public service, I am very pleased to be able to fill my final moments as a public official with giving.” He added, “I hope this donation will be of some help so that neighbors who are marginalized in the cold weather can have a warm winter.”



The Hope 2023 Sharing Campaign, hosted by the Gyeongbuk Community Chest, will continue fundraising until January 31 of next year, and the donations made on this day will be delivered to neighbors in need within the district through the respective organization.
